This is a 3 level map pack i made that consists of maps that were originally intended to be in my mod later got removed. I connected them nicely but you can still see some incosistency between each one's style. It has custom textures and instances. Test Chamber signs made with Omnicoders app and everything else by me. It has 5 puzzles overall ranging from easy to medium difficulty. If you rate the map please leave a comment too, especially if its a low score.

IMPORTANT
The last map is poorly optimized and the floor buttons are a little glitchy so dont give them a hard time. I would have thrown away the last map but by the time i realized it had a few too many problems i had already finished it.
